Twitter is partnering with Ballotpedia, a non-profit, civic organization that publishes nonpartisan information on federal, state, and local politics. US election labels will appear on the campaign Twitter accounts of candidates running for state Governor, or for the US Senate or US House of Representatives, during the 2018 US midterm general election. The labels contain relevant information about a political candidate, including the office the candidate is running for, the state the office is located in, district number (when applicable), and will be clearly identifiable with a small icon of a government building.”]
